Are you inadvertently missing out on some revenue? Many primary care physicians are probably providing but not billing for the following six services:
_ Tobacco cessation counseling
_ Home health or hospice certification
_ Home health and hospice care plan oversight
_ Medicare pelvic exams
_ Prostate cancer screening
_ Prolonged services for inpatient care
